IMAX Signs 10-Cinema China Deal

January 11, 2008 Source: IMAX

IMAX Corp. will install 10 of its giant-screen cinemas in China in its biggest sale in Asia to date in a deal announced Thursday amid a boom in Chinese moviegoing. The deal with China's Wanda Cinema Line Corp. includes seven screens using IMAX digital projection technology that is still in development, said IMAX, which is based in suburban Toronto. The price of the deal was not announced.

Investors are rushing to open new cinemas in China as incomes rise and more people go to the movies.

The country of 1.3 billion people has 3,900 screens.

Mainland box office revenues for 2007 are expected to total about $400 million, up 15 percent from 2006, according to industry estimates reported by state media.

The IMAX deal reflected the growing Chinese movie market outside the prosperous cities of Beijing and Shanghai.

The first two systems are to be installed in Changsha in the south and Changchun in the northeast, followed by Beijing and the eastern cities of Nanjing and Wuxi, IMAX said. It said other locations were under discussion.

Screens in the new cinemas will measure 44 1/2 by 72 1/2 feet, according to IMAX.
